Vegetable garden plants:- four tomato
- 2 cucumber
- 2 Jamaican pumpkin (brought seeds from Jamaica in April)
- callaloo, of course (Kia's Franken-callaloo already reach breakfast plate, planted seeds from Jamaica and they are sprouting and need some thinning out)
- Just today saw the scotch bonnet seedlings sprout -thought I had lost them. Couple more weeks I'll transfer to vegetable bed
In pots/planters are:- Thyme
- oregano
- greek basil
- chives
- swiss chard (dem look pyaw pyaw)
- Jamaican ginger - 3 likkle plants come up from 3 piecea ginger mi bring back from Ja
Peppermint and spearmint come up and is like ground cover under maple tree. Mint tea mek nuff times and neighbors helping themselves to it.
Training two clematis to grow up on pergolaEarly Spring planting of evergreen shrubs (for year round backyard privacy) looking like they'll make it - English laurel, nandina, euyonemous, and rhododendron.
Will be in yard all day tomorrow weeding out flower beds
Giving thanks for the rain.

As calalloo sprout from seeds planted straight in the ground, I pull out the taller plants by roots then prep these for breakfastThis also thins out the calalloo patch.
Kale still growing in planter and I cut some leaves and cook it up with the calalloo too.
Jamaican thyme from seeds not growing. Gwine replant some more and see what happens.
